    Abstract: A lock device includes a locking unit, a connecting unit, and a latch. The locking unit includes a shank, a rotation knob, a control wheel, a plurality of number wheels, a plurality of locating pieces, and a plurality of snap-fit members. The shank has a first positioning hole. The rotation knob has a second positioning hole combined with the first positioning hole of the shank by a positioning member. Thus, the user has to detach the positioning member from the first positioning hole of the shank to release the rotation knob so as to rotate the rotation knob for changing the code of the number wheels, thereby preventing the user from changing the code of the number wheels freely when rotating the rotation knob unintentionally.

    Abstract: A lock structure including an activation device, a combination lock, and a setting device is provided. The combination lock has a plurality of dials, a shaft passing through the dials, and a plurality of first gears disposed on one side of each dial. Each first gear further includes a missing tooth. One end of the shaft is connected to the activation device. The setting device has a plurality of second gears corresponding to the first gears and a setting shaft, wherein one end of the setting shaft passes through the second gears and the other end is connected to the activation device. When the activation device is activated, the second gears are driven to rotate the first gears, so that when each second gear runs free with the missing tooth of each first gear, the dials are in a predetermined position. That is, by means of the activation device and the setting device, the dials of the combination lock can automatically return to the predetermined position after opening or closing the lock.

    Abstract: A tamper-resistant pill bottle for securely storing a quantity of medication. The pill bottle includes a receptacle, a cap for fitting over the receptacle, and a combination lock integral with the cap for releasably locking the cap to the receptacle. The combination lock includes a series of combination wheels that partially protrude through a sidewall of the cap and can be rotatably manipulated by a user. The combination for the combination lock can be set by a user upon receipt of the pill bottle. The pill bottle further includes an inconspicuous defeat mechanism integral with the cap for allowing the pill bottle to be opened, preferably by a pharmacist, if a user forgets the combination of the combination lock.

    Abstract: A motorized oven latch includes a base plate. A latch member is slidably connected to the base plate by a first mounting stud or first and second mounting studs connected to the latch member and located in a contoured slot defined in the base plate. The latch member includes an inner end and an outer end, and the outer end includes a hook adapted to engage an oven door. A motor is drivingly coupled to the latch member, and the motor is selectively operative to move the latch member forward and rearward relative to said base plate between a locked position and an unlocked position, wherein the latch member moves on a non-linear path relative to the base plate in response to movement of the first mounting stud or both the first and second mounting studs in the contoured slot when the motor moves the latch member forward to the unlocked position or rearward to the locked position.

    Abstract: A combination resetting member for a cable lock mainly contains a stationary piece and a movable piece. The movable piece is concentrically positioned inside the stationary piece and two diametrically opposing pins penetrates through the stationary piece, two grooves of the movable piece, and into two corresponding holes on the tip of a column of a female lock member. The movable piece has two diametrically opposing flanges on the front surface and two diametrically opposing blocks on the back surface. The flanges and the blocks are orthogonal to each other. Corresponding to each of the blocks but on the front surface, there are a shallower U-shaped groove and a deeper U-shaped groove. The movable piece can be forced to move orthogonally to the pins and the pins therefore could shift from the shallower grooves to the deeper grooves and vice versa.

    Abstract: A combination lock for personal luggage such as a suitcase or briefcase comprising a pivotably mounted latch member capable, when in a latched condition, of securing a cooperating tongue member and a bolt for locking the latch member in its latched position, the bolt being spring biassed to a release position and so moved to the release position when projections from the bolt can engage in respective recesses in cams, which cams are each individually rotatable by and with a respective one of a plurality of wheels manually indexable around and bearing visible markings. The cams are normally interlocked for rotation each with its respective wheel but the interlocking can be released to enable the combination of the lock to be changed.

    Abstract: A latching device for apertured members, such as the sliders of a double-slider zipper employed as a closure on a luggage case, has a latch pivotally mounted on a body member and an upstanding stud which is adapted to be covered by the latch when in latched position. The latching device employs a latching mechanism which is operated by the movement of the pivoted latch without the necessity of manipulating a secondary, manual actuator, thereby permitting the latching device to be operated with one hand. The device includes a pair of plungers slideably disposed within a housing, the plungers having end portions extending beyond the housing which are shaped for cooperation with cams attached to the underside of the latch. The plungers are driven into the housing by the cams when the latch is lowered or raised. When the latch is open, the plungers are held partially driven into the housing, thereby reducing the downward force necessary to close the latch.

    Abstract: A dial and sleeve type combination lock is provided with a shift member to move the sleeves out of coupling engagement with the dials for changing the combination of the lock. The shift member includes a manual actuator extending through an opening in the face plate of the lock which opening extends transversely to the axis of the sleeves and movement of the actuator in the opening in the transverse direction effects axial movement of the sleeves by means of an oblique camming surface on the shift member.

    Abstract: Coded lock for blood transfusion bags of the type having a locking flap. A pin extends through the locking flap of the bag. A numerically coded lock locks the pin through the flaps. A numerical code is set into the lock. The numerical code is attached to the patient's wrist. At the patient's location the nurse reads the code attached to the patient's wrist and opens the bag.

    Abstract: A dial type combination lock having a plurality of individual locking units each of which consists of a locking means and a dial means. The locking means has a pair of discs, one of which is a leading disc in which are a plurality of the holes at locations coinciding with the numbers displayed on the number carrying portion of the dial, and the other of which is the locking disc having a locking bolt receiving notch therein and a pin that is to be fit into one of the holes corresponding a designated number. The locking disc of each locking unit is connected with the leading disc thereof by the pin on the locking disc engaging in the hole in the leading disc corresponding with the designated number for the respective locking member and connecting shafts connect all the locking means to the dial means, so that during the operation of the lock, the locking bolt receiving notches in each of the locking discs are individually set in the bolt receiving position.
